From b79a402cdbbecfcab661f1c24028b51dd704b2e0 Mon Sep 17 00:00:00 2001
From: tjx <t2856754968@163.com>
Date: 星期三, 03 十二月 2025 20:34:38 +0800
Subject: [PATCH]  1 feat: 完善质量检测消息推送功能并添加测试    3 - 实现 MesQaDingtalkService.sendQaMsgSJ 方法,支持发送包含检验单号、物料编码、物料名称、车间、线体、工单号、检验结果等详细信息的钉钉消息    4 - 添加 MesQaDingtalkServiceTest 测试类,包含正常和异常情况的单元测试

---
 src/main/java/com/gs/dingtalk/service/impl/SendDingtalkServiceImpl.java |   10 ++++++++++
 1 files changed, 10 insertions(+), 0 deletions(-)

diff --git a/src/main/java/com/gs/dingtalk/service/impl/SendDingtalkServiceImpl.java b/src/main/java/com/gs/dingtalk/service/impl/SendDingtalkServiceImpl.java
index c267e80..0659d43 100644
--- a/src/main/java/com/gs/dingtalk/service/impl/SendDingtalkServiceImpl.java
+++ b/src/main/java/com/gs/dingtalk/service/impl/SendDingtalkServiceImpl.java
@@ -83,6 +83,16 @@
     }
 
     @Override
+    public void sendDingTalkFifteenMinute() throws Exception {
+        LambdaQueryWrapper<SendDingtalk> wrapper = new LambdaQueryWrapper<>();
+        wrapper.eq(SendDingtalk::getFifteenMinuteReminder, 1);
+
+        List<SendDingtalk> list = list(wrapper);
+
+        getMessage(list, 15);
+    }
+
+    @Override
     public void sendDingTalkthirtyMinute() throws Exception {
         LambdaQueryWrapper<SendDingtalk> wrapper = new LambdaQueryWrapper<>();
         wrapper.eq(SendDingtalk::getThirtyMinuteReminder, 1);

--
Gitblit v1.9.3